Let’s get started, here’s the basic heart pattern in UK terms:

MATERIALS & TOOLS NEEDED

Yarn: Stylecraft Special DK 

Hook: Hook to match yarn and your desired gauge. I used a 3mm.

Scissors

Darning Needle

PATTERN NOTES

Written in UK terms

The video tutorial can be found after the written pattern.

PIN FOR LATER

CROCHET TERMS

Chain (ch): Yarn over, pull through one loop on hook

Ch-Sp: Chain space

Double Crochet (dc): Insert hook into stitch, yarn over, pull through two loops (2 loops on hook), yarn over, pull through both loops.

Half Treble Crochet (htc): Yarn over and insert your hook into the chain or stitch, yarn over and pull through (you will have three loops on the hook) yarn over and pull through all three loops on the hook.

Treble Crochet (tc): Yarn over, insert hook into stitch, yarn over, pull through (3 loops on hook), (yarn over, pull through 2 loops) twice.

Double Treble Crochet (dtr): Yarn over TWICE and insert your hook into the chain or stitch, yarn over and pull through (you will have four loops on the hook) yarn over and pull through two loops on the hook (you will have three loops on the hook)  yarn over and pull through two loops on the hook (you will have two loops on the hook)  yarn over and pull through the remaining two loops on the hook.

Sl St: Slip stitch

Stitch(es) (st(s))

If you’d prefer US terms, please visit Planet June for the original pattern.

CROCHET HEART PATTERN

Make a magic ring, ch 2.

Rnd 1: (3 dtr, 4 tr, dtr, 4 tr, 3 dtr) into magic ring.

Pull the magic ring mostly closed, leaving a small space in the middle, ch 2, sl st into the remaining hole in the magic ring. Pull the magic ring tightly closed.

Rnd 2: dc in ch-sp, 2 htc in same ch-sp, 3 htc in next ch-sp, 2 htc in next ch-sp, htc in next 3 ch-sps, 2 htc in next ch-sp, htc, tr, htc in next ch-sp, 2 htc in next ch-sp, htc in next 3 ch-sps, 2 htc in next ch-sp, 3 htc in next ch-sp, 2 htc in next ch-sp, dc in next ch-sp, sl st in first ch-sp.

Fasten off.

HEART BOOKMARK

To create this cute bookmark, you need to make one basic heart, chain to your desired length and then make a mini heart which is just Round 1 of the heart pattern.
